Caprice View with Ruins is a work by Italian artist Francesco Guardi (1712 - 1793). It's one architecture oil on panel painting created in 1780. The painting is owned by the museum of National Gallery London, one of the museums with the most Francesco Guardi works, and is accessible to the general public. Francesco Guardi was influenced by Baroque, and made most paintings about cityscape and architecture.
